The book "Power Quality in Power Distribution Systems Concepts and Applications" provides a comprehensive overview of power quality (PQ) and its significance in power distribution systems. The book covers the fundamental concepts of PQ, including voltage sag, voltage interruption, and harmonics, and explores the impact of these disturbances on electrical equipment and the power grid. It also discusses various methods for measuring and improving PQ, including filtering techniques and compensation strategies. Additionally, the book examines the challenges associated with PQ and offers solutions for mitigating its effects. The book begins by introducing the concept of power quality and its importance in power distribution systems. It explains that PQ refers to the degree of compatibility between the power supply and the load, and that it plays a crucial role in ensuring the reliable operation of electrical equipment and the stability of the power grid. The book then delves into the various factors that affect PQ, such as voltage fluctuations, frequency variations, and current harmonics, and discusses how these disturbances can cause equipment damage, downtime, and energy waste. Next, the book explores the different types of PQ disturbances, including voltage sag, voltage interruption, and harmonics, and their impact on electrical equipment.
